Plaid acts as an intermediary between apps (like Venmo) and your bank so that you can log in and share data securely.
As more and more personal finance apps (think Robinhood, Venmo, Current, etc.) pop up, developers need ways to connect to and access your bank accounts
That connection is notoriously difficult - each bank has its own idiosyncratic APIs, legacy architectures, and ugly UX
Plaid provides a connection layer for developers to easily connect to and work with bank accounts, and a simple UI for users like you to log in
While the product might sound really simple and easy to understand, there’s a lot of hard work going on behind the scenes that enables that smooth experience. And the company is in the news - after a $5B acquisition by Visa got blocked by the DOJ, they’re independent again and ready to grow.

Plaid is a 3rd-party payment processor that allows ACH transfers between accounts. When you get the email that final payment is due, access to Plaid is enabled.
